Head to head by decade
| Decade | Armenia | Botswana |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.6% | 36.1% | 34.5% | Botswana |
| 1970s | 0.3% | 32.5% | 32.2% | Botswana |
| 1980s | 0.1% | 14.2% | 14.0% | Botswana |
| 1990s | 0.1% | 1.4% | 1.3% | Botswana |
| 2000s | 0.2% | 0.1% | 0.1% | Armenia |
| 2010s | 0.1% | 0.1% | 0.0% | — |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
